Am I mad and destitute
on this anxious road to success?
Or am I lost and found again
in artless vanity and regret?
Is this path I walk alone
of the living and the dead?
Or a marathon that leads me on
far from a shameful mess?
Do you hear my silken cries
or feel my sullen tears?
Do you smile all the while
or simply laugh at me?
Am I selfish or justified
to think and feel this way?
Or is it just another cross
I think I bear, today?
Will you pray for me again
as I walk the quivering wire?
Trying not to glance below
into the waiting fire.
No, You will hold me subtly
each and every time I tire.
You will always ease my pain:
right here, right now, in time.
